    Abstract: A method and a system for maintaining session continuity, in which the system includes a Handover Source Function (HOSF), a Handover Destination Function (HODF), a Handover Anchor Function-Control Plane (HOAF-CP) and a Handover Anchor Function-User Plane (HOAF-UP). The method includes a first user establishing a connection through the HOSF with the HOAF-CP and the HOAF-UP which correspond to a second user, so as to establish a session with the second user. The method further includes that, during session handover, the HODF that corresponds to the HOSF establishing another connection with the HOAF-CP and HOAF-UP though which the first user continues the session with the second user, so as to maintain the session continuity. When access address or access technology of the terminal changes, or even the terminal changes during a session, the method and the system can logically replace the connection before the handover with a new connection to ensure the session continuity.

    Abstract: The present invention relates to a crown-shaped separation device for separating oil and water in a well. Separator joints are sleeved on a central tube, and a separator is arranged between adjacent separator joints. Settlement cups are sleeved on the central tube, and two adjacent settlement cups are inserted together. A multi-rib separating bowl is embedded in the settlement cup. The settlement cup is crown shape. The bottom of the settlement cup is formed with multiple ribs. An angle is formed between the convex rib of the bottom of the settlement cup and the horizontal line. The top edge of the settlement cup is sawtooth shape corresponding to the shape of the cup bottom. An annular space is formed between the cup base of the settlement cup and the central tube. The central tube corresponding to the annular space is provided with a fluid inlet.

    Abstract: Systems, methods, and devices for bearer independent protocol gateway performance optimization are described. In one aspect, a bearer independent protocol gateway is provided in the device which includes a traffic analyzer configured to detect when HTTP transaction(s) (request and corresponding responses) is/are completed and to switch to the next socket as soon as the transaction is completed, without necessarily waiting for the TCP socket to be closed. For example, when the gateway detects that the response is complete, it may push the current socket back into a socket queue and start serving the next socket.

    Abstract: Methods and apparatus are disclosed to capture error conditions in lightweight virtual machine managers. A disclosed example method includes defining a shared memory structure between the VMM and a virtual machine (VM), when the VM is spawned by the VMM, installing an abort handler on the VM associated with a vector value, in response to detecting an error, transferring VMM state information to the shared memory structure, and invoking the abort handler on the VM to transfer contents of the shared memory structure to a non-volatile memory.

    Abstract: A system and method are disclosed for performing on die jitter tolerance testing. A set of clocks are generated based on an input signal. The set of clocks include in an in-phase signal based on the data switching edge of the input signal. Additionally, the set of clocks include an inverted clock phase shifted by 180 degrees, and a pair of clocks phase shifted positively and negatively by a certain number of degrees, ?. Data input is sampled based on the inverted clock and the two phase shifted clocks. The eye opening of the input signal can be determined based on whether each of the inverted clock and the two phase shifted clocks sample the correct data from the input signal at various ? values.

    Abstract: Technology is discussed for supporting wireless communication paths from an antenna array with a vertical directional component. Examples reduce training feedback for increased numbers of communication paths by only reporting on a subset of Reference Signals (RSs) provided for various vertical beam configurations. Additional examples reduce feedback with virtual measurements based on a difference between RS measurements. One such measurement can come from full set of RSs for a reference beam configuration and another from a partial set of RSs for an additional beam configuration. Such virtual measurements can also be based on cross correlation for beamforming weights associated with the two configurations. Several examples of preparing and sending measurement reports consistent with Third Generation Partnership Project (3GPP) Long Term Evolution (LTE) standards are discussed.

    Abstract: One feature pertains to an integrated circuit, comprising an access transistor and an antifuse. The access transistor includes at least one source/drain region, and the antifuse has a conductor-insulator-conductor structure. The antifuse includes a first conductor that acts as a first electrode, and also includes an antifuse dielectric, and a second conductor. A first surface of the first electrode is coupled to a first surface of the antifuse dielectric, a second surface of the antifuse dielectric is coupled to a first surface of the second conductor. The second conductor is electrically coupled to the access transistor's source/drain region. The antifuse is adapted to transition from an open circuit state to a closed circuit state if a programming voltage Vpp greater than or equal to an antifuse dielectric breakdown voltage is applied between the first electrode and the second conductor.
